The Benefits of Thatch House Design

Thatch House Design Thatch house design is a great way to add a unique, natural aesthetic to your home while providing insulation and protection to your living environment. Thatch, which is typically made from local grasses, reeds, and straws, can keep temperatures comfortable in both hot and cold climates alike. It also provides excellent waterproofing capabilities, making it an ideal choice for damp environments. Thatch roofs are often designed with an overlapping pattern, which not only helps to protect the home from the elements but also creates an attractive and eye-catching design.

Durability

Thatch House Design Thatch house design is renowned for its durability. It can withstand harsh weather conditions such as heavy wind, snow, and rain, and will often last for many years, depending on the type of thatch used and how well it is cared for. In addition, thatch is flexible and therefore won't snap or crack during extreme weather conditions, unlike some other types of roofing material.

Price

Thatch House Design Another benefit of thatch house design is that it is cost-effective compared to other roofing materials. Thatch is generally readily available in most parts of the world, and it can be harvested or collected in large amounts quite easily. The price is also generally inexpensive compared to other roofing materials, making it an attractive option for many homeowners.
